Electrolux Dishwasher Error Code i59
Wash pump current read ADC fault
What the i59 error code actually means
Your Electrolux dishwasher has detected an electrical problem with the motor that pumps water during the wash cycle. The control board measured unusual electrical current in the pump motor's wiring and shut things down to prevent damage. This could be caused by a wiring problem, a failing pump motor, or a fault on the control board itself.

Most common causes of i59
- 1Damaged or loose wash motor wiring harness
- 2Failed wash pump motor with internal winding short
- 3Corroded or contaminated motor connector pins
- 4Faulty main control board (MCB) ADC circuit
- 5Wash pump motor seized or mechanically obstructed
